Acadiana Home School Athletics won the last time they faced Southwest Louisiana HomeSchool and things went their way on Thursday too. The Commandos blew past Southwest Louisiana HomeSchool 3-0. While the Commandos didn't have the best season last year (they finished 6-11), it's starting to look like those struggles are a thing of the past.
While Acadiana Home School Athletics won a shutout, things came down to the wire in the second set they played.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-18, 25-22, 25-16.

Acadiana Home School Athletics got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Leo Mader out in front who had 12 digs, five kills, three aces, and two blocks. Mader has been hot, having posted five or more kills the last five times he's played. The team also got some help courtesy of Elijah Chopin, who had seven kills, four digs, and one block.
The win made it two in a row for Acadiana Home School Athletics and bumps their season record up to 6-2. As for Southwest Louisiana HomeSchool, they dropped their record down to 0-2 with the defeat, which was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season.
Acadiana Home School Athletics and Southwest Louisiana HomeSchool will both get a bit of extra prep time before their next contests. The next time the Commandos see the court they'll take on Lake Area HomeSchool Sports at 6:30 p.m. on the 26th. As for Southwest Louisiana HomeSchool, their break will end when they face Midstate Homeschool at 7:00 p.m. on September 9.
